CASANOVA, MARVELOUS M. and JULIAN, FERNANDO D. JR. Proposed Design of Sewage Treatment Plant for Bgry. Salitan 1, City of Dasmariñas Cavite. Undergraduate Design Project.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ering, Cavite State University Indang, Cavite. June 2022. Adviser: Engr. Renato B. Cubilla.
The research paper entitled "Proposed Design of Sewage Treatment Plant for Brgy. Salitran 1, City of Dasmariñas Cavite" was conducted from September 2020 to June 2022 at the Cavite State University-Main campus under the supervision of Engr. Renato B. Cubilla. Based on projected household wastewater discharge, the study aimed to design a sewage treatment plant for Brgy. Salitran 1, City of Dasmariñas Cavite. The study provided information on the various sizes of tanks used to treat wastewater. The study also included architectural and structural plans for the sewage treatment facility, as well as cost estimates. Structural Aided Analysis and Design Software was used to analyze each structural member (STAAD). The structural design of the building is based on the National Building Code of the Philippines (NSCP) and ACI Code Standards. The project cost was Php.76,111,364.00.
